Are you in the US?
I'm not sure what you mean by G1 though.
There are a few Diamond Select phaser's laser modded on ebay but the asking prices tend to be extreme. If your good with your hands modding them is doable but be prepared for alot of cutting and grinding and sanding. You will also need to cut and replace the plastic nozzle with a aluminum one to basicly use as a heatsink but still be prop accurate.
Battery placement is also an issue, or better put lack of a battery box so you have to be creative and put them in the handle. Powering the laser and the P1 at the same time you will need to set up a switch from scratch or add a micro limit switch.
A ebay member "JonPaul2012" sells some parts as a aluminum nozzle that extends inside to take a 12mm module and has some tutorials. I wouldn't run more than 3W's though as battery capacity will be and issue and the biggest batterys iv'e seen them built with is 2 16340's.
I have a Diamond Select phaser that I modded with a 532nm laser module that still has the original plastic nozzle but it's only a balloon popper.
I found it easier and cheaper to mod these Rubies Brand with good power as other than the P1 not being removable, its a great copy of the real prop.
